20 Tips to Get your Paperwork organised today
Use these tips to get your organising off to a flying start!
 
  • FILING
        • When storing important documents, they don't need to be as easily accessible as your home file - so consider storing out of reach - this is also more secure.
        • Consider using a fireproof box, or storing with professionals for extra security
        • Scan each document into your computer so you have a backup should anything happen to the original

        • Only keep items for the time that they are needed - there is no point in keeping last years car insurance paperwork when this years has arrived, just get rid of them and you will keep on top of the paperwork.
        • When setting up a filing system, ensure that each section is clearly defined - and DO NOT have a MISC section as you will never find anything once filed - make each section specific - its better to have lots of easily found sections than a messy vague filing system where you still can't find anything.
  • MAGAZINES
        • When reading magazines, fold down the corner of any pages that have interesting articles or things you need to keep - when you have finished reading the magazine rip out all the pages that you want, and get rid of the rest.
        • Make the most of free gifts with subscriptions - its cheaper to buy magazines this way, and the gifts are often things that you would buy anyway or that would make good gifts for others
        • Keep only current issues, unless you really need to keep them for work or a hobby - ask yourself will you honestly ever have time to read them again?
        • Think about sharing subscriptions with friends, if you have 3 close friends, why not each get one magazine, and share so you get the benefit of 3 magazines to read each month without having to pay for more than 1.

        • Ask yourself if you need to buy magazines or newspapers at all - can you get the information you need online?
        • Make time to read in your life - otherwise you will end up with a pile of papers that you will one day get round to reading - take them with you in your bag so that when waiting in a queue or having a coffee you have something on you that you really want to read.   • MAIL
        • Immediately open all mail and get rid of the junk mail and any unneeded items - have a bin by where you open the post to make this as easy as possible
        • Have a place to put each member of the households post each day
        • Have all mailing items (stamps, paper, envelopes, address book) in one place so that its easy to reply to anything, or send things to people
        • Have a system set up if you don't have time to deal with post there and then - a good system is a simple tray system where you have the following - ACTION, FILE, OUTGOING, KEEP FOR NOW or similar
              • ACTION - these will be invitations to reply to, bills to pay etc...
              • FILE - anything thats simply for filing such as a car insurance certificate
              • OUTGOING - Any cards and post or school letters that need to go out of the house (check this each time you leave the house to keep on top of it)
              • KEEP FOR NOW - items that you don't need to do anything with, but will be required - i.e. vouchers, invitations that you have replied to but need to keep for address details etc...
        • Keep a shredder near to the bin also so that you can destroy any personal information that is to throw away
        • Try to deal with all outgoing mail at the same time so that it saves you rushing to catch the post
        • Don't let things build up - deal with it daily, and definately don't let the piles blend together or get bigger than the space they are allocated - you want to only touch paperwork once if possible.
        • Subscribe to the Royal mails OPT OUT services to lessen your unwanted mail - http://www.royalmail.com/portal/rm/content1?catId=400126&mediaId=500081
        • Cancel any catalogue subscriptions you have with stores you haven't bought from for a while - also consider cancelling them all if you have internet access as you will be able to find all the most up to date information there.
